Network requirements
As shown in
Figure
103:
A secure SSH connection has been established between Switch A and Switch B;
Switch A is used as the SFTP server, and its IP address is 10.111.27.91;
Switch B is used as the SFTP client;
An SFTP user is configured with the username 8040 and password 3com.
